Klamath County Clerk Marriage ApplicationsBirth Records, Death Records, Divorce Records, Employee Directory, Genealogy Records, Marriage Records, Vital RecordsHere are the necessary details for obtaining a marriage license in Klamath County:
1. **Requirements**:
- Both applicants must appear in person at the County Clerk's office.
- Valid identification (such as a driver's license, passport, or state ID) is required.
- Applicants must be 18 years or older, or meet the criteria for minors.
2. **Instructions**:
- Fill out the application form available at the Clerk's office or online.
- Pay the applicable fees (check the current rates on the official website).
- Review any additional local requirements that may apply.
3. **Application Process**:
- Visit the Klamath County Clerk's office during business hours to submit your application.
- The marriage license will be issued upon approval.
- There is usually a waiting period before the license becomes valid; verify the specific timeframe.
For detailed and up-to-date information, refer to the Klamath County Clerk's official resources.
